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6497675105 460087 795027
6512 4103202269 34564338
6512 4103202269 34564338
618701441 41903116 486 4399
All about undefined
Interested in learning more?
6512 4103202269 34564338
618701441 41903116 486 4399
See more
06 1593693 68
7699810338 96 198527
See more
560778120 030919343
844 3216769 8795084 81261
See more